通常通过VSFTPD软件实现的Ubuntu的FTP(FTP通过SSL/TLS)服务器可以通过一组配置测量来提高安全性。 以下是一些重要的步骤和建议:
安装和配置VSFTPD
安装VSFTPD:首先,从软件包管理器中安装VSFTPD软件包。 在Ubuntu上,您可以使用以下命令安装它:
sudo apt updatesudo apt install vsftpd
VSFTPD配置:编辑VSFTPD配置文件(通常位于/ETC/VSFTPD.CONF中),以指定FTP root Directory,限制匿名访问等,根据需要创建自定义配置
您可以启用SSL/TLS加密来增强FTP服务器的安全性,并配置FTP服务器以使用TLS/SSL加密发送数据。 配置防火墙如果系统启用了防火墙(例如UFW),则必须配置防火墙规则以通过FTP流量。 例如,端口20(FTP数据传输)和端口21(FTP控制连接)可以通过防火墙。 用户管理创建FTP用户,将主目录设置为特定目录,从而限制用户仅访问主目录。 通过编辑VSFTPD配置文件,用户可以限制对特定目录的访问。 例如,您希望用户仅访问其主目录。 定期更新和监视系统和软件包更新以修复已知的安全漏洞。 监视系统日志并快速检测可疑活动。
请注意,以上信息提供了Ubuntu FTPS服务器安全性的概述,并且您可能需要根据您的实际环境和要求调整特定配置。
以上内容来自互联网,并不代表本网站的所有视图! 关注我们:zhujipindao .com
评论前必须登录!
注册